Wind Turbines
Wind turbines are large, tall structures with blades that rotate and harness the power of the wind to generate electricity. These renewable energy sources can be found both onshore and offshore, and are used to produce clean, sustainable energy for homes, businesses, and communities. Wind turbines are a key component of the transition to more environmentally friendly sources of power, helping to reduce reliance on fossil fuels and decrease carbon emissions.
